diff --git a/appStore/users/models.py b/appStore/users/models.py index 4abd504f3bffc9b32a3ea66c17b78c642aa560d2..bd731f2715a66639075ceabd2a35c3196ded5f1f 100644 --- a/appStore/users/models.py +++ b/appStore/users/models.py @@ -1,22 +1,11 @@ from django.contrib.auth.models import AbstractUser from django.db import models - -# Create your models here. -# 能否只取一层,不行就写字段 -# class UserProfileGroup(models.Model): -# """用户组""" -# name = models.CharField(unique=True, max_length=32) -# -# class Meta: -# db_table = 'user_profile_group' - - class UserProfile(AbstractUser): """ 用户模型类 """ - user_phone = models.CharField(unique=True,null=True, max_length=22, verbose_name='手机号') + user_phone = models.CharField(unique=True, null=True, max_length=22, verbose_name='手机号') chinese_name = models.CharField(max_length=255, unique=True) is_superuser = models.BooleanField(default=False, verbose_name='是否是管理员') diff --git a/kytuningProject/asgi.py b/kytuningProject/asgi.py index a452a34276828ccd7693d93b48702c34c2d2dc54..5009dd946646c11f5fabba56f8c024a06adf1dc0 100644 --- a/kytuningProject/asgi.py +++ b/kytuningProject/asgi.py @@ -11,6 +11,6 @@ import os from django.core.asgi import get_asgi_application -os.environ.setdefault('DJANGO_SETTINGS_MODULE', 'djangoProject.settings') +os.environ.setdefault('DJANGO_SETTINGS_MODULE', 'kytuningProject.settings') application = get_asgi_application() diff --git a/kytuningProject/settings.py b/kytuningProject/settings.py index 4f0e106be944d84c1c0d3bc7ce030592ecf01432..7ae30eee30113313cd9038a4df669bb95dbbec10 100644 --- a/kytuningProject/settings.py +++ b/kytuningProject/settings.py @@ -52,6 +52,7 @@ INSTALLED_APPS = [ 'appStore.cpu2006.apps.Cpu2006Config', 'appStore.cpu2017.apps.Cpu2017Config', ] +AUTH_USER_MODEL = 'users.UserProfile' MIDDLEWARE = [ 'django.middleware.security.SecurityMiddleware', 'django.contrib.sessions.middleware.SessionMiddleware', @@ -62,12 +63,10 @@ MIDDLEWARE = [ 'django.middleware.clickjacking.XFrameOptionsMiddleware', 'corsheaders.middleware.CorsMiddleware', 'django.middleware.common.CommonMiddleware', - ] -ROOT_URLCONF = 'djangoProject.urls' +ROOT_URLCONF = 'kytuningProject.urls' CORS_ORIGIN_ALLOW_ALL = True - CORS_ALLOWED_ORIGINS = [ 'http://127.0.0.1:8080', # 允许从这个地址发出跨域请求 # ... @@ -76,8 +75,7 @@ CORS_ALLOWED_ORIGINS = [ TEMPLATES = [ { 'BACKEND': 'django.template.backends.django.DjangoTemplates', - 'DIRS': [BASE_DIR / 'templates'] - , + 'DIRS': [BASE_DIR / 'templates'], 'APP_DIRS': True, 'OPTIONS': { 'context_processors': [ @@ -90,13 +88,14 @@ TEMPLATES = [ }, ] -WSGI_APPLICATION = 'djangoProject.wsgi.application' +WSGI_APPLICATION = 'kytuningProject.wsgi.application' # Database # https://docs.djangoproject.com/en/4.1/ref/settings/#databases DATABASES = { 'default': { + # todo 需要修改为自己的数据库及密码 'ENGINE': 'django.db.backends.mysql', 'NAME': 'kytuning', 'HOST': 'localhost', @@ -151,7 +150,6 @@ STATIC_URL = 'static/' DEFAULT_AUTO_FIELD = 'django.db.models.BigAutoField' - PASSWORD_HASHERS = [ 'django.contrib.auth.hashers.PBKDF2PasswordHasher', ] diff --git a/kytuningProject/wsgi.py b/kytuningProject/wsgi.py index eca644f26a76eb59ac1edeaec8589a22d5340133..b7a4163dd8ff4652d85e9f6028437af2f8d744b7 100644 --- a/kytuningProject/wsgi.py +++ b/kytuningProject/wsgi.py @@ -11,6 +11,6 @@ import os from django.core.wsgi import get_wsgi_application -os.environ.setdefault('DJANGO_SETTINGS_MODULE', 'djangoProject.settings') +os.environ.setdefault('DJANGO_SETTINGS_MODULE', 'kytuningProject.settings') application = get_wsgi_application() diff --git a/manage.py b/manage.py index 652ec40f3ebdce37798226663e981bd48aa75caf..f63b93b307a4ac3d2a496555974f01ebd53b1c7d 100644 --- a/manage.py +++ b/manage.py @@ -6,7 +6,7 @@ import sys def main(): """Run administrative tasks.""" - os.environ.setdefault('DJANGO_SETTINGS_MODULE', 'djangoProject.settings') + os.environ.setdefault('DJANGO_SETTINGS_MODULE', 'kytuningProject.settings') try: from django.core.management import execute_from_command_line except ImportError as exc: diff --git a/requirements.txt b/requirements.txt index 6710b032de495157b1266188c53df5f1b4dcb179..3419d88ce1a332a5889b9c43a5041ea553e81da2 100644 --- a/requirements.txt +++ b/requirements.txt @@ -6,4 +6,5 @@ djangorestframework-jwt==1.11.0 numpy==1.21.6 django-filter==23.2 uWSGI==2.0.19.1 -openpyxl==3.1.2 \ No newline at end of file +openpyxl==3.1.2 +schedule==0.3.2 \ No newline at end of file diff --git a/templates/front-project/src/components/TableHome.vue b/templates/front-project/src/components/TableHome.vue index 0ee41632a82bc02e9e4f8a5b4bf61d1908ce5b05..93d679eb04e80875867cc8efc4f5ea125da5b0b6 100644 --- a/templates/front-project/src/components/TableHome.vue +++ b/templates/front-project/src/components/TableHome.vue @@ -23,14 +23,12 @@